Evening Shades Exec Summary

Recently at the Pittsfield Mall Outlets location of Evening Shades, the management has become increasingly frustrated at its inability to motivate associates to perform the duties assigned to them. After cycling through numerous associates, it is clear that some problem must exist that is preventing new hires from understanding their duties enough to accomplish them.

A survey of our associates was designed and administered to determine what the causes of the confusion could be. The results of this survey confirmed that a lack of consistent training was one contributing cause. Currently, corporate permits twenty-four hours of training. However, this region permits only nine of those twenty-four hours because of payroll constraints.

Additionally, associates appeared frustrated and confused about the tasks assigned to them. One reason was found to be the lack of a common template available for managers to use when assigning store tasks. As a result, managers are left to their own devices to compose documents for assigning tasks and monitoring employee completion. The great variation in the documents used by managers was found to cause confusion among employees. To rectify these issues, two solutions are recommended:

ï‚· First, a consistent training regimen totaling the corporate-allotted twenty-four hours should be implemented.

ï‚· Second, standard templates for in-store memoranda should be implemented to improve associate performance and reduce employee turnover.

Victorian Exec Summary Description

2.3 Executive Summary The executive summary follows the title page and should make sense on its own. The executive summary helps the reader quickly grasp the reportâ€TMs purpose, conclusions, and key recommendations. You may think of this as something the busy executive might read to get a feel for your report and its final conclusions. The executive summary should be no longer than one page. The executive summary differs from an abstract in that it provides the key recommendations and conclusions, rather than a summary of the document.
